    [QUOTE=jewel;91705]so for my Biotin users.. how many mg do you take?
    I just talked to the doc and got the green light for protein shakes for a week. But they are totally opposed to me drinking my calories
    From now on, I sprinkle everything I eat with parmesan cheese (2 tsp = 2g protein) and will be adding a scoop of any whey to my greek yogurt at lunch time (14g from the yogurt and 17g from the AnyWhey). Sometimes I just need people to give me ideas on what to put in my mouth..
    Lunch today? 1/2 an apple dipped in PB2 paste (fake peanut butter-18 g protein).. mmm!


    Sometimes I love having a dietician a phone call away.

    I use the unflavored protein powder Unjury to sprinkle on my foods. I eat pure protein bars, you can usually get them for $1 each or a case at Sam's or Costco. Skim evaporated milk has 19grm of protein in a cup. You can also try the Fage greek yogurt has 12g. I never ate oatmeal, and I now love it. Make it really "soupy" with skim milk and boil it with a cinnamon stick for flavor. I hope this helps.

    Quote Originally Posted by Tuliptwy View Post
    Hi Jewel. I had a lot of trouble getting protein in and so I've been losing hair for a while and quite a bit (well, to me). I've been faithful to my protein and vitamins (including biotin) and it's slowed down. My understanding is that after ANY major surgery you will have hair loss - just the way things are. I saw my hairdresser and she reminded me that we lose, on average, 160 hairs per day without anything being out of kilter. She suggest I count the hairs the next time I think I've lost a whole bunch and I'll be shocked that it's really not as much as it seems. Hope this helps. Also, I use Unjury unflavoured protein with Crystal Light and have two drinks per day - they're 20 g of protein each with ZERO calories!! With how little you're taking in though, a few calories in a protein shake won't hurt you. All the best in your journey.
    Jewel - I was wrong on the calories. The unflavoured has 80 calories and the strawberry sorbet (tastes like kool-aid) has 100 calories. Just wanted to clarify.
